检测到您已登录华为云国际站账号,为了您更好的体验,建议您访问国际站服务网站 https://www.huaweicloud.com/intl/zh-cn
不再显示此消息
和circumference()两个函数。 通过在特殊的exports对象上,指定额外的属性,函数和对象可以被添加到模块的根部。 模块内的本地变量是私有的,因为模块被装在一个函数中。 在这个例子中,变量PI是circle私有的。 在这个例子中,导入circle 的时候需要在其名称上添加命名空间的字段才可以正确导入。
Connect实例所在的服务区。 服务集成 APIC连接地址 ROMA Connect服务集成APIC的网关地址。 服务集成APIC(API Connect,简称APIC)是ROMA Connect的API集成组件。APIC将数据和后端服务以API形式开放,简化分享数据或提供服务的过程
图表信息:设置图表的背景,支持设置背景的颜色、四边圆角(取值为“0”时为直角,“100”为圆角)。 数据 在数据中,设置组件的数据来源。更多介绍,请参见如何调用后台接口。 图4 设置组件数据 事件 在事件中,查看组件可配置的事件列表。更多关于事件的介绍,请参见初识事件-动作。 图5 设置事件 父主题: 全局高级组件
在右侧“数据”页签,配置该数据系列的数据。 例如,在使用系统预置的静态数据基础上,添加如下加粗代码,配置新增数据系列的数据。也可以使用“动态数据”调用后台接口URL返回如下结构模型数据。 图3 新增数据系列 { "resCode": "0", "resMsg": "成功", "result":
型都包含参数定义和方法定义。方法是在模型上定义的API,通常会在前台组件关联的事件脚本(例如页面加载事件、鼠标单击事件)中调用这些API,以实现某些功能。 表1 模型来源说明 分类 模型说明 模型参数的定义 模型方法的定义 API调用方法 自定义函数 开发者自由定义的模型。 由开发者自定义,可以添加子节点。
边框圆角:设置图表的边框圆角。 坐标系位置:设置坐标系与组件上下左右边距距离的百分比。 数据 在数据中,设置组件的数据来源。更多介绍,请参见如何调用后台接口。 图4 设置组件数据 事件 在事件中,查看组件可配置的事件列表。更多关于事件的介绍,请参见初识事件-动作。 图5 设置事件 父主题: 全局高级组件
属性:组件的属性展示区域,通过修改组件的属性,使页面达到预期效果。 事件:事件编排器的入口,通过系统预置的事件编排器,或者直接定义JS代码,来实现页面组件与后台接口之间的交互。 库:加载当前页面所依赖库的入口。页面设计的某些功能需要依赖特定的库来完成,用户可以在该页签下新增或删除某些库。低代码平台提供
理。标准页面预置了几种与工作流流程相关的事件,供工作流关联标准页面时使用。 BPM-提交实例 该预置动作用于将数据提交到工作流,与预置的API“context.$工作流.submitInstance (variables:object)”效果相同。 选中相关组件(如按钮),在右侧
描述:轻应用的描述信息。 服务项 在服务项页面,可查看并删除该应用的组件(例如标准页面、BPM、脚本等)。 API和事件 在API和事件页面,可查看BO所有对外的API和事件。 应用: 在应用页面,可查看应用引用的其他应用、BO以及Native Service信息。 父主题: 如何设置应用
但是也正因为表单内置了此类动作,其界面也相对固定,无法定制。 在高级页面中与BPM交互 在高级页面中也提供了类似的API,但由于高级页面使用了懒加载的方式,其API表达为闭包形式: 获取变量: $bpm(op => op.loadVariables(variables)) 提交实例:
BPM的开始类型,可以从“Star”开始图元下进行配置。开始种类包括如下两种: 自定义:默认为“自定义”,即不指定事件的起因,即不需要指定触发条件,主要用于接口调用进行启动。 表单:使用表单或页面启动BPM。选择该项时,需要配置具体的表单、标准页面或高级页面。 一般选择“自定义”,当BPM由表单或者页面启动时,选择“表单”类型。
在右侧“数据”页签,配置该数据系列的数据。 例如,在使用系统预置的静态数据基础上,添加如下加粗字体代码,配置新增数据系列的数据。也可以使用“动态数据”调用后台接口URL返回如下结构模型数据。 { "resCode": "0", "resMsg": "成功", "result": [{ "order":
参数。 图17 新增参数 表3 新增参数说明 参数 说明 clientId 在AstroZero环境上部署应用需要调用AstroZero的接口,这里需要配置通过“客户端模式”OAuth鉴权的客户端ID。 字符串类型参数。 需要自定义默认值,配置为“客户端模式”OAuth鉴权的客户
thisObj.getConnectorProperties(); / API to get base path of your uploaded widget API file */ var widgetBasePath =
BPM-提交实例 该预置动作用于将数据提交到工作流,与预置的API“context.$工作流.submitInstance (variables:object)”效果相同。 BPM-提交任务 该预置动作用于将数据提交到工作流,与预置的API“context.$工作流.submitTask
标准页面支持表1中四类模型,每类模型都包含参数定义和方法定义。方法是在模型上定义的API,通常会在前端组件关联的事件脚本(例如页面加载事件、鼠标单击事件)中调用这些API,以实现一定的逻辑。 表1 模型说明 模型分类 模型说明 模型参数的定义 模型方法的定义 API调用方法 自定义模型 自定义模型是由开发者自由定义的模型。
其他场景下,在AstroZero中可通过创建ROMA连接器,实现与应用与数据集成平台(ROMA Connect)的对接,对接后通过调用ROMA Connect的API,间接访问数据库。更多介绍,请参见对接华为云ROMA Connect。 父主题: 产品咨询类
插入console.log()。 图2 Sources页签布局 调用低代码平台API 在Console页签下,可使用控制台调用低代码平台提供的API,以获取相关信息进行调试。 图3 调用低代码平台API 断点调试 在Sources页签下,可以设置断点来调试JavaScript。使
如果包管理下,还没有已发布的应用包,请先将当前应用编译打包。如何编译打包应用,请参见应用打包发布。 图1 选择包类型下的应用包 将下载到本地的应用包,发送给其他需要安装该应用的用户。 如何通过导入方式安装应用 导入方式安装应用时,支持导入源码包和资产包两种类型,两者的差异如下:
和访问零代码应用。以在Welink PC端使用AstroZero开发和访问零代码应用为例,故此处请下载并安装WeLink PC客户端。如果本地PC机已安装WeLink客户端,则无需执行此步骤。 步骤2 绑定WeLink 以租户账号登录开发环境,绑定WeLink并同步WeLink信息。